First grade needs a backpack, a linen backpack. I bit the bullet and made the toddler backpack from Rae's pattern, I enlarged it by 2 inches and used a bigger zipper (all noted in the pattern). I didn't line the bag and I'm pleased with it. I did goof on enlarging the body, I forgot to add 2 inches to the length, so I cut down the bottom because I could not figure out what was wrong. It wasn't until the next morning, it clicked, oh well, her folders fit in there. I will make another just to make it correctly. As a quick pattern review, I like it, reccomend it, and will make another, it is a PDF only, and I'm a fan of that, no tracing and I just read the instructions from iBooks on the iPad.
